Kashmir's Spice Secrets Revealed

The video demonstrates kashmiri lal mirch's transformative role in traditional dishes. Unlike generic chili powder, this sun-dried pepper delivers vibrant color without excessive heat. Observing her technique reveals critical nuances:

  • Whole-to-powder conversion: Crushing dried peppers retains oils better than pre-ground
  • Low-heat infusion: Simmering spices in oil unlocks flavors without burning
  • Patience pays off: As she notes, "covering and cooking it for a long time" develops depth

Practical Vlogging Toolkit

Filming Around Cooking Challenges

Smoke interference during standing shots isn't just annoying—it breaks viewer immersion. Proven solutions include:

ProblemFixWhy It Works
Smoke in eye-lineSide-angle tripod placementAvoids direct airflow
Glare from cookwarePolarizing filterReduces metallic reflection
Audio interferenceLavalier mic under collarBlocks sizzle interference

Actionable checklist:

  1. Test camera angles before cooking
  2. Seal lids tightly to minimize smoke
  3. Keep a damp cloth nearby for lens wiping
